If you need to find child care on the weekends, it can help to have a budget in mind. The average hourly rate for weekend child care near you in Woodland, WA is $18.50 per hour. However, the exact rate you’ll pay will depend on a few important factors like the caregiver’s years of experience and how many children you have.
